The chapter delves into the transformative approach of quality by design (QbD) in drug formulation. Moving beyond traditional, reactive methods, QbD emphasizes a science-based, proactive strategy to ensure consistent, high-quality medications. It starts with clearly defined goals (desired therapeutic effect, safety profile) and identifies critical quality attributes (CQAs) of the final product. Risk assessment pinpoints potential areas of variability, allowing formulation design within a defined “design space” where CQAs remain optimal. Control strategies ensure process consistency throughout manufacturing. This chapter explores key tools such as design of experiments (DoE) for optimizing formulations, process analytical technology (PAT) for real-time monitoring, and multivariate data analysis for a deeper understanding. Practical applications across various dosage forms (oral, parenteral, topical) are showcased, along with successful case studies. Challenges and opportunities are discussed, including regulatory considerations, data management, and future advancements in QbD technologies. Ultimately, this chapter highlights how QbD empowers the pharmaceutical industry to deliver safe, effective, and consistently high-quality drugs, benefiting patients and healthcare professionals alike.
